为什么选择Unity3D作为游戏开发入门引擎?
提起游戏,多数人都能聊上几句,但涉及游戏开发的具体门道,真正熟悉的人并不多。在众多游戏开发工具中,Unity3D凭借其跨平台兼容性、可视化编辑界面和丰富的资源库,成为移动端、PC端甚至VR/AR领域的主流开发引擎。从《王者荣耀》的部分场景搭建到《精灵宝可梦Go》的AR交互实现,再到建筑可视化、虚拟仿真等非游戏领域的应用,Unity3D的技术覆盖度远超普通开发者认知。
对于零基础学习者而言,Unity3D的学习曲线相对平缓——无需从底层代码开始啃起,通过可视化组件拖拽即可完成基础场景搭建;而对于进阶开发者,其支持C#脚本深度扩展的特性,能满足复杂逻辑开发需求。这种“易入门、深拓展”的特点,使其成为游戏开发培训的首选工具。

火星时代Unity3D课程的三大核心优势
作为国内少数受邀参展GDC(游戏开发者大会)的培训机构,南京火星时代的Unity3D课程始终保持与国际前沿技术同步。在往届GDC展会上,火星时代不仅将学员自主开发的《镜面人生》等作品带到国际舞台,更与Epic Games、Valve等行业巨头技术团队深入交流,将VR交互优化、跨平台性能调优、次世代画面渲染等前沿技术融入课程体系。
1. 全流程项目实训,贴近企业需求
区别于传统理论教学,火星时代采用“企业级项目制”教学模式。学员入学后将按4-6人组建开发小组,从需求分析、原型设计到代码编写、测试上线,全程模拟游戏公司开发流程。课程后期更会引入真实游戏厂商外包项目,例如2023年学员参与开发的《星际探险》休闲手游,其部分场景模块已正式上线应用商店。
2. 技术资源库持续更新,覆盖多领域应用
课程内容不仅包含游戏开发,还延伸至虚拟现实(VR)、增强现实(AR)、数字孪生等新兴领域。例如针对VR开发,学员将学习Oculus、HTC Vive等主流设备的适配方案;针对工业仿真方向,会涉及物理引擎优化、数据可视化等专项技术。这种“游戏+泛娱乐”的课程布局,让学员选择更广泛。
3. 导师团队兼具行业经验与教学能力
授课导师均来自腾讯、网易等游戏大厂,平均拥有5年以上项目开发经验。例如负责引擎底层教学的张老师,曾参与《阴阳师》场景引擎优化;主讲VR开发的李老师,主导过某头部科技公司的虚拟展厅项目。他们不仅能传授技术细节,更会分享实际开发中的“避坑指南”,例如如何避免内存泄漏、如何与美术团队高效协作等。
从零基础到独立开发,课程学习路径详解
火星时代Unity3D课程采用“阶梯式”学习体系,将整个学习周期划分为四大阶段,确保学员从基础概念到复杂项目逐步进阶。
阶段一:基础能力构建(1-4周)
重点掌握Unity3D引擎界面操作、游戏对象(GameObject)与组件(Component)的关系、基础物理引擎应用。通过“滚球游戏”“2D跑酷”等小项目,熟悉场景搭建、角色控制、碰撞检测等核心功能。同时同步学习C#编程语言,理解面向对象编程思想,为后续脚本开发打基础。
阶段二:中级技术深化(5-8周)
进入3D游戏开发模块,学习模型与材质导入、光照系统设置、动画控制器(Animator Controller)使用。此阶段会引入“人称射击游戏”“开放世界探索”等中等复杂度项目,重点训练场景优化(如LOD层级细节)、资源管理(如AB包打包)、多平台适配(Android/iOS)等技术。
阶段三:高级技术突破(9-12周)
聚焦VR/AR开发与商业项目实战。VR部分将学习设备交互(如手柄输入、头部追踪)、空间定位(如Inside-Out追踪技术)、晕动症优化等专项技术;AR部分则涉及Marker识别、SLAM定位、3D物体锚定等核心功能。此阶段项目将与企业需求直接对接,例如为某文旅景区开发AR导览程序,或为教育机构制作VR实验模拟课程。
阶段四:冲刺与作品打磨(13-16周)
学员将集中精力完善个人作品库,包括优化过往项目代码、补充技术文档、制作演示视频。同时开展模拟面试、简历优化等指导课程,邀请游戏公司HR分享招聘偏好(如更看重项目经验还是技术深度)、常见面试问题(如“如何优化游戏加载速度”)等实用内容。部分优秀学员更有机会直接获得合作企业的内推资格。
选择火星时代Unity3D课程的现实意义
据《2024中国游戏产业人才发展报告》显示,国内游戏行业从业人员中,掌握Unity3D开发技术的占比超过60%,且企业招聘需求仍以每年15%的速度增长。对于求职者而言,拥有火星时代Unity3D课程的项目经验,相当于持有一张“行业通行证”——学员作品库中的企业级项目案例,往往能成为面试时最有力的竞争力。
更重要的是,火星时代的教学模式不仅学员“如何做游戏”,更培养“解决问题的能力”。从引擎报错的排查到跨团队协作的沟通,从项目进度的把控到用户需求的理解,这些软技能的提升,才是支撑职业长期发展的核心竞争力。